10 new cases of COVID-19 in B.C., one additional death

Jun 26, 2020 | 2:58 PM

VICTORIA–A total of ten new cases of COVID-19 were reported in today’s joint statement by B.C.’s Provincial Health Officer, and Minister of Health.

None of the new cases were in the Northern Health region, the north remaining at 65 test positive cases for yet another day.

Cases by Health Region:

  • Vancouver Coastal Health: 969
  • Fraser Coastal Health: 1,514
  • Vancouver Island Health: 131
  • Interior Health: 199
  • Northern Health: 65

B.C.’s total of test-positive cases is now at 2,878 cases–this includes a data correction of one case from yesterday’s report. At the moment there are 159 active cases in the province, with 17 people in hospital, of those five are in ICU.

One new death was reported in the Vancouver Coastal Health region, bringing the provincial death toll to 174.

No new community or health care outbreaks have been reported. 2,545 people have recovered from COVID-19.
